Course details
Blockchain Fundamentals: This unit covers the basic concepts of blockchain technology, including its history, architecture, and key components such as nodes, blocks, and transactions. •
Smart Contract Development: This unit focuses on the development of smart contracts, which are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ement written directly into lines of code. This unit covers the use of programming languages such as Solidity and Chaincode. •
Blockchain Security and Risk Management: This unit explores the security risks associated with blockchain technology, including 51% attacks, quantum computing threats, and smart contract vulnerabilities. It also covers risk management strategies and best practices for securing blockchain-based systems. •
Blockchain for Supply Chain Management: This unit examines the application of blockchain technology in supply chain management, including the use of blockchain to track inventory, verify authenticity, and improve transparency and efficiency. •
Blockchain in Hospitality: This unit explores the potential applications of blockchain technology in the hospitality industry, including the use of blockchain to enhance guest experiences, improve operational efficiency, and increase revenue. •
Blockchain for Guest Services: This unit focuses on the specific use cases of blockchain technology in guest services, including the use of blockchain to manage guest data, track loyalty programs, and provide personalized experiences. •
Blockchain Data Analytics: This unit covers the use of data analytics tools and techniques to analyze and interpret blockchain data, including the use of data visualization tools and machine learning algorithms. •
Blockchain Governance and Regulation: This unit explores the regulatory framework for blockchain technology, including the use of blockchain in various industries and the potential for blockchain-based governance models. •
Blockchain for Identity Verification: This unit examines the use of blockchain technology in identity verification, including the use of blockchain-based identity management systems and the potential for blockchain-based identity verification solutions. •
Blockchain for Payment Systems: This unit covers the use of blockchain technology in payment systems, including the use of blockchain-based payment platforms and the potential for blockchain-based payment systems.
